SUMMARY DESCRIPTION

This is an ideal opportunity for an enthusiastic AR Cash application specialist wishing to develop world class accounting and business experience within a highly successful NASDAQ quoted medical devices company.

SUPERVISION RECEIVED

Under direct supervision of the Accounts Receivable Manager

ESSENTIA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ES

To perform this job successfully, an individual must be able to perform each essential duty satisfactorily:

  • Responsibility for daily application of cash received for assigned entities
  • Reconcile and apply previously unidentified / "on account" payments
  • Raise debit and credit memos as required
  • Ensure relevant SLAs and KPIs are met
  • Cash Application reflects the appropriate payment value
  • Only valid and confirmed payments and credits are applied
  • All payments received are posted against invoices in a timely manner
  • Provide customer payment information to the collections team as required
  • Resolve allocation queries with Collections Team
  • Process Intercompany and PNC netting transactions monthly in Oracle
  • Process Credit Card payments from US customers
  • Liaise closely with Bank Reconciliations Team
  • Escalate issues in accordance with escalation policy
  • Be proactive and innovative with ideas to improve service
  • Flexibility around working hours required during specified key periods (month end)
